ORDER
Date : 18.02.2026 Heard Mr. T. Chakraborty, learned counsel for the petitioner; Mr. P. Sharma, learned Standing Counsel, Assam Fishery Development Corporation Limited for the respondent nos. 1 & 2; and Ms. U. Das, learned Additional Senior Government Advocate, Assam for the respondent nos. 3 & 4.
2. In view of the nature of grievance raised by the petitioner in this writ petition, this writ petition is taken up for final consideration, as agreed to by the learned counsel for the parties, by making the notice returnable forthwith.
3. The case projected by the writ petitioner can be narrated as follows :- Pursuant to a Notice Inviting Tender [NIT] dated 25.05.2018 issued by the respondent Assam Fisheries Development Corporation [AFDC] Limited vide NIT No.01/2018, the petitioner submitted his bid in respect of a fishery named Doloni Fishery [‘the Fishery’, for short] located in Bongaigaon District for a period of seven years and in the tender process, the petitioner emerged as the highest valid bidder. However, vide an Order dated 16.02.2019, the Fishery was settled with the petitioner for a period of six years only instead of seven years with the condition that the extension of the settlement for the 7th year would be considered at a later stage. Accordingly, in the year 2019, the possession of the Fishery was handed over to the petitioner and thereafter, the petitioner came to know that about 25% area of the Fishery was under illegal encroachment. Immediately after coming to know about such illegal encroachment, the petitioner time and again requested the respondent authorities to clear the Fishery from the encroachers. The respondent AFDC Ltd. had, in turn, also made several requests to the District Administration of Bongaigaon to clear the Fishery from the encroachers.
3.1. Thereafter, vide an Order dated 26.06.2025 issued by the respondent no. 2, the settlement of the Fishery was extended for the 7th year till 31.03.2026 considering the fact that the original NIT for settlement was issued for seven years. In order to obtain such extension, the petitioner had to approach the Court by filling a writ petition, W.P.[C] no. 1728/2025. The Fishery was cleared from encroachment only in January, 2026 and w.e.f. 2019 till January, 2026, the petitioner could not operate the entire Fishery because of such encroachment.
3.2. The NIT dated 25.05.2018 in respect of the Fishery was issued with the projection that the total area of the Fishery comprised of 867 Hectares [Land] and 300 Hectares [Water]. The petitioner has contended that he participated in the said NIT with an expectation that he could utilize the entire area of the Fishery but a huge portion of the Fishery covering about 25% area was under encroachment, which was cleared only in January, 2026. That apart, during 2020 and 2021, the petitioner also suffered huge loss in running the Fishery due to Covid 19 pandemic and for imposition of various restrictions by the Government.
